Default Re: 25NL same Villain, within 2 hands

First hand check behind, but why the min-raise on the turn? Either I'm betting it up, or I'm calling with position. Not sure what a minraise accomplishes there.

Second hand, PUSH. You only have $18 left with a $28 pot. Anything else would look odd. Bet $8-10 and it screams CALL ME!!! Bet anymore and you might as well push. Check behind and you're leaving value on the table. That being said, I would have liked to see an $11 bet on the turn. It helps to discourage the draws on this board and it would have made a $34 pot, leaving you with only $15 behind and the push would seem like the only reasonable option. If he folds due to a missed draw, you also get more money from him.

*** good point also by the previous poster. ~$3 into a $5.60 pot is begging those draws to chase, when you should be punishing those draws. At this level they'll chase regardless, so make them pay. I would have made it $5, to make it appear like a normal C-Bet. Raising the flop more, also allows for a bigger and more reasonable turn bet, that still isn't pot sized, and makes the river shove even easier.
